What is an injector pressure in heavy vehicles? Why it is used?

Injector pressure in heavy vehicles refers to the pressure at which fuel is delivered into the engine's combustion chamber. This parameter is of utmost importance in diesel engines, particularly in the context of heavy-duty vehicles like trucks and buses. The primary purpose of injector pressure is to ensure that the diesel fuel is sprayed into the combustion chamber as a fine mist, facilitating efficient combustion.

Efficient combustion is the cornerstone of using injector pressure in heavy vehicles. When fuel is atomized effectively, it mixes thoroughly with the incoming air, resulting in a more complete and efficient combustion process. This, in turn, has several significant benefits.

Firstly, injector pressure directly impacts the power output of the engine. In heavy vehicles, the engine must produce substantial power and torque to move substantial loads. Maintaining the right injector pressure ensures that the engine can generate the necessary force to accomplish this efficiently.

Furthermore, injector pressure is closely tied to fuel economy. When fuel combustion is efficient, the engine can extract more energy from each unit of diesel, resulting in reduced fuel consumption. This is not only economically advantageous but also contributes to environmental goals by lowering carbon emissions.

Injector pressure also plays a vital role in emissions control. By enabling efficient combustion, it minimizes the production of harmful pollutants such as nitrogen oxides (NOx) and particulate matter (PM). In an era of increasing environmental awareness and stricter emissions regulations, this aspect is crucial for the heavy vehicle industry.

Additionally, maintaining the right injector pressure helps enhance the durability of engine components. Proper combustion reduces wear and tear on vital engine parts, leading to longer service intervals and decreased maintenance costs for fleet operators.

Finally, consistent injector pressure is essential for ensuring reliable engine performance under varying load conditions and during diverse driving scenarios.

In summary, injector pressure in heavy vehicles is a critical parameter with far-reaching implications. It impacts engine performance, fuel efficiency, emissions, durability, and overall reliability. This parameter is a cornerstone of modern diesel engine technology, enabling heavy vehicles to operate efficiently, economically, and in an environmentally responsible manner.
